Vogel Alcove is a non-profit organization dedicated to addressing the issue of homelessness, particularly for families with young children. This resource offers a range of services including therapeutic programs, school services, case management, and health and wellness programs. This comprehensive approach aims to assist homeless families by providing the tools and resources necessary to help them overcome adversity and secure a more stable future. Their primary focus is on serving the youngest homelessness victims, children, by providing them with a safe, nurturing environment where they can learn, grow and thrive, thus breaking the cycle of homelessness.
